Package Details: xorgxrdp-git 0.2.10-1

Git Clone URL: https://aur.archlinux.org/xorgxrdp-git.git (read-only)
Package Base: xorgxrdp-git
Description: Xorg drivers for xrdp
Upstream URL: https://github.com/neutrinolabs/xorgxrdp
Licenses: MIT
Submitter: matmoul
Maintainer: matmoul
Last Packager: matmoul
Votes: 10
Popularity: 0.085065
First Submitted: 2017-04-19 18:53
Last Updated: 2019-05-30 11:54

Latest Comments

matmoul commented on 2017-10-04 19:37

@Aelius :

From the the first version I've packaged, each time the release method has changed...
Need to use the master and after develop but master was the release and now master is not sync...
I've maked the last version based on the release file.

Now, I will wait the next release to adjust the code.

Aelius commented on 2017-10-04 18:29

This isn't a git package in the ways that matter.

1) It doesn't have a pkgver() function; users cannot easily follow the commits
2) It uses the master branch, which is equivalent to release (for this package). You want to check out the devel branch.

Please adjust accordingly. Use this pkgbuild as a reference https://aur.archlinux.org/cgit/aur.git/tree/PKGBUILD?h=xrdp-devel-git

matmoul commented on 2017-05-08 18:13

@dszryan :

And don't mess to add allowed_users=anybody to /etc/X11/Xwrapper.config (you need to create the file) to allow anybody to start X

matmoul commented on 2017-05-08 18:10

@dszryan :

For xorgxrdp, we don't use Xvnc but Xorg. It's a good alternative to X11rdp.
In /etc/xrdp/sesman.ini and /etc/xrdp/xrdp.ini, the config section is [Xorg] and I use the default config provided by xrdp.

But for work, you only need to edit /etc/X11/xinit/xinitrc (for all user) or ~/.xinit.rc (for a specific user) to launch the good DE.

As exemple, I have edited the end of my /etc/X11/xinit/xinitrc (comment or delete the default cmd twm, xclock and xterm and add your DE start cmd) :
#twm &
#xclock -geometry 50x50-1+1 &
#xterm -geometry 80x50+494+51 &
#xterm -geometry 80x20+494-0 &
#exec xterm -geometry 80x66+0+0 -name login
exec dbus-run-session -- startkde

With this, I can use Plasma5 with RDP and it work better for me than X11rdp.

dszryan commented on 2017-05-08 10:32

i had to make the following edit to get the terminal server to work under the 'sesman-any' config.

/etc/xrdp/sesman.ini
[Xvnc]
param=Xvnc
param=-bs
param=-nolisten
param=tcp
;param=-localhost
param=-dpi
param=96

/etc/xrdp/xrdp.ini
[sesman-any]
name=sesman-any
lib=libvnc.so
ip=127.0.0.1
port=-1
username=ask
password=ask
#delay_ms=2000

should have the package updated as well?